Call for Essays: Voices of the Next Generation on Black Sea Nuclear Security
The Black Sea Women in Nuclear Network is pleased to announce the 2026 Student Essay Competition, organized in conjunction with its Annual Regional Conference “The Nuclear Workforce: Building Security, Driving Progress,” which will take place in Sofia from 28–30 April 2026.
The competition aims to highlight the perspectives of emerging scholars and practitioners on the evolving nuclear landscape in the Black Sea region. Students are invited to submit original essays exploring critical challenges and opportunities related to nuclear security, non-proliferation policy, regional nuclear energy developments, and the implications of emerging technologies.
The authors of the three top winners will receive a full travel grant to attend the BSWN Conference in Sofia, where they will have the opportunity to present their work to a community of regional and international experts.
The competition is open to citizens of Bulgaria, Georgia, Moldova, Romania, Türkiye, and Ukraine who are currently enrolled in undergraduate, master’s, or doctoral programs, or who have graduated within the past two years.
Submission deadline: 25 March 2026
